Mahilee Top (12,500 feet), Kullu – Manali

Mahilee Top Trek offers a heartwarming view of the Dhauladhar range, Kaliheyni Pass and its lofty mountain peaks. Pleasing open valley view from all angles could be cherished forever. One can also get to see the panoramic mountain view and a 360-degree view of the Manali Valley. Mahilee Thach offers a nice view of South. North, East and West side valley, at a full stretch. Distant snowcapped mountains of Chanderkhani Pass and Fojhal valley also can be viewed.

During this trek we will face snow and glaciers. We will have to walk on snow. The most pristine trekking route, the Mahilee Top trek leaves you thrilled and excited as you pass by gushing streams, dew drenched grassy slopes and white snow. Winding your way through a series of gradual ascents and descents. Experience the flora and fauna of Himachal Pradesh.

Conventionally, the trek commences from the Base camp (15 mile) Manali and traverses you through flower-studded meadows of Mahilee Thach, finally leading to Mahilee Top from where the descent starts and leads back to Base camp. The striking and amazing beauty of the mountains and enchanting trekking trails that offer breath-taking views of 'Hanuman Tibba', 'Deo Tibba' and 'Indrasan' peaks of the Pir-Panjal Himalayan range will certainly leave you mesmerised.
